**Q: How do I restore access to the TideGlass widget's config store if the primary credentials are rotated out from under me?**

A: This happens more often than you'd think during onboarding. The TideGlass tide-table widget caches harbor predictions locally, but its config store at Brinmoor requires an unlock step after any rotation. Open the recovery console, select the widget's tenant, and enter the passphrase shown below when prompted.

recovery phrase for fahap-haduf: casvan-eliius-novmir-holiel-oliwyn-brivan-gilax-gilael-gilax-wenius-rusael-istius-ralys-julwyn

Minutes — Management Meeting, Acquisition Review

Present: Chair Denholt Vas, CFO Irella Mund, COO Pavet Rin. The board reviewed the proposed acquisition of Lanterwick Analytics. Diligence on its Hallovar operations is 80% complete; valuation range was narrowed and integration risks were catalogued. Legal flagged two open licensing questions, now assigned to counsel. Directors should treat the appended note below as strictly confidential.

internal memo for kaduf-baduf: Only 35 of the 378 pilot accounts renewed Holir, so a churn review is set for June 11. Eliielax Group is in early talks to buy Silaelix Group for about $142.1 million.

Welcome to the Lunavault payments team. The integration suite occasionally fails on the ledger-reconciliation tests because the sandbox clearinghouse stub resets its state every ten minutes. Before filing a flake report, rerun the suite twice and capture the full harness output. If the failure persists, attach the trace token shown below to your ticket.

pipeline stamp: htk9_ce63042d9

Step 4: Configure Rotawheel, our internal secrets-rotation utility. Rotawheel runs as a sidecar in the Pinecrest cluster and rotates downstream credentials on a weekly cadence. New team members should note that Rotawheel itself needs one bootstrap credential to authenticate to the vault service before it can manage anything else; this is the only secret we set by hand. Create the env file from the template in the deploy repo, verify the vault endpoint, and then add the bootstrap line beneath it.

sealed setting: VAULT_KEY8=a77b1885